Population Overview
Thibodaux is a small city located in Louisiana, within Lafourche Parish. The total population is 15,732. It ranks as the 31st most populous out of 488 Census-designated places in Louisiana.
Age Demographics
The median age in Thibodaux is 39.0 years. This is 3% higher than the state median of 38.0 years.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Thibodaux is $52,072. This is 14% lower than the state median of $60,756. It is also 36% lower than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 19.6%. This is 4% higher than the state poverty rate of 18.9%. The unemployment rate is 4.3%. This is 32% lower than the state rate of 6.3%. The median home value is $232,500. Housing costs are 7% higher than the state median of $216,500. The home-value-to-income ratio is 4.5x. 61.6%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 9% lower than the state average of 67.4%.
Race & Ethnicity
The largest racial or ethnic group in Thibodaux is White (non-Hispanic), making up 67.0% of the population. Black or African American residents account for 23.1%.
Education
34.6%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This places Thibodaux in the top 10% of all cities in the state for educational attainment. This is 28% higher than the state rate of 27.0%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 85.4%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Thibodaux, Louisiana is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against Louisiana state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 488 Census-designated places in Louisiana.
